Author talk and book signing on January 27, 2026, 12-1 pm at Capitol Books and Gifts, on the lower level in the California State Capitol Museum. Join us in the museum store for a presentation by California author Eddie Ahn of “Advocate,” a graphic memoir of family, community and the fight for environmental justice. Mr. Ahn has been an environmental justice attorney and nonprofit worker for 15 years. He is a self-taught artist who has been recognized as a cartoonist-in-residence by the Charles M. Schulz Museum in Santa Rosa California.
Event will feature a presentation by the author, discussion, and book signing. Registration fee includes a copy of “Advocate,” tote bag, and limited edition illustrated print by Mr. Ahn.
